[Title] => 5 US warships here for Carat 2004
[Summary] => SUBIC FREEPORT Activities were aplenty and familiar inside the former ship repair facility here as five US battleships with 1,400 US sailors arrived for the eight-day joint military exercise under the Philippine-US Mutual Defense Treaty.
Dubbed as Cooperation Afloat Readiness and Training (CARAT) Exercise, the yearly joint training is aimed at promoting the inter-operability between Filipino and American forces in combined naval operations.
The exercises will be held simultaneously in Zambales and Cavite until Aug. 4.
